WebRoutes within the backbone, or a non-backbone area are computed as a link-state protocol does (ref Dijkstra's algorithm ). When OSPF must carry non-backbone routes through the backbone, it uses some distance-vector behavior (i.e. parts of the Bellman Ford algorithm) to propagate Type3 LSA metrics into non-backbone areas.
